+Cadence GPIO controller bindings
+
+Required properties:
+- compatible: should be "cdns,gpio-r1p02".
+- reg: the register base address and size.
+- #gpio-cells: should be 2.
+ * first cell is the GPIO number.
+ * second cell specifies the GPIO flags, as defined in
+ <dt-bindings/gpio/gpio.h>. Only the GPIO_ACTIVE_HIGH
+ and GPIO_ACTIVE_LOW flags are supported.
+- gpio-controller: marks the device as a GPIO controller.
+- clocks: should contain one entry referencing the peripheral clock driving
+ the GPIO controller.
+
+Optional properties:
+- ngpios: integer number of gpio lines supported by this controller, up to 32.
+- interrupt-parent: phandle of the parent interrupt controller.
+- interrupts: interrupt specifier for the controllers interrupt.
+- interrupt-controller: marks the device as an interrupt controller. When
+ defined, interrupts, interrupt-parent and #interrupt-cells
+ are required.
+- interrupt-cells: should be 2.
+ * first cell is the GPIO number you want to use as an IRQ source.
+ * second cell specifies the IRQ type, as defined in
+ <dt-bindings/interrupt-controller/irq.h>.
+ Currently only level sensitive IRQs are supported.
+
+
+Example:
+ gpio0: gpio-controller@fd060000 {
+ compatible = "cdns,gpio-r1p02";
+ reg =<0xfd060000 0x1000>;
+
+ clocks = <&gpio_clk>;
+
+ interrupt-parent = <&gic>;
+ interrupts = <0 5 IRQ_TYPE_LEVEL_HIGH>;
+
+ gpio-controller;
+ #gpio-cells = <2>;
+
+ interrupt-controller;
+ #interrupt-cells = <2>;
+ };
